In Talcahuano, Chile, October showcases a delightful transition into spring, with temperatures ranging from a comfortable maximum of 24°C (76°F) to a cooler minimum of 2°C (36°F). The average temperature hovers around 12°C (54°F), offering a pleasant climate for outdoor activities. However, residents can expect approximately 41 mm (1.6 in) of rain over about 7 days, contributing to the region's lush landscapes. With humidity levels at a moderate 76%, October in Talcahuano invites visitors to experience its vibrant atmosphere while accommodating occasional showers.

In October, Talcahuano experiences a noticeable shift in precipitation, with 41 mm (1.6 in) of rain falling over the month, which marks a significant decrease from the wetter months that precede it. This rainfall typically occurs across seven days, suggesting a gradual tapering off of the heavy rains seen in June and July, where over 100 mm fell each month. As the city transitions from late winter to spring, the drier pattern sets the stage for the upcoming summer months, characterized by significantly reduced precipitation amounts. This trend reflects a broader climatic pattern, revealing how Talcahuano's weather evolves throughout the year, with October acting as a bridge between the heavy rains of winter and the drier conditions of late spring.
October in Talcahuano, Chile, showcases a notable decline in humidity, settling at 76%. This month marks a shift from the peak levels seen during the winter months, where humidity reached its highest at 86% in July. As spring unfolds, the gradual decrease from the 83% observed in May provides a refreshing contrast to the heavier, damp air of the previous months. Following the wetter late winter and early spring, October's humidity is relatively moderate, hinting at a transition towards summer's drier conditions. This trend of minimizing humidity continues into November with a further drop to 72%, emphasizing Talcahuano's dynamic climate throughout the year.
